Hence it is important to learn how the hc 05 bluetooth module interfacing with the microcontroller. The bluetooth is a halfduplex protocol transmitting and. Select the driver tab and the bluetooth driver version number is listed in the driver version field. Ultralowpower 32bit microcontrollers mcus maxim integrated. Nowadays, demands of mobile phones and personal communication the bandwidth are easy and convenient to use. Max32565 secure arm cortexm4 with fpubased microcontroller. The l298 is an integrated monolithic circuit in a 15lead multiwatt and powerso20 packages. Our approach to bluetooth low energy ble is simple. Development platform for the ultralow power microcontroller for wearables max32630fthr. Integrating simple bluetooth functionality without. Can i connect a bluetooth module without a microcontroller. Practical implementations of bluetooth in microcontroller circuits john a.
Quickly get up and running with microcontroller development boards that let you explore every feature of our ultralowpower mcus. And the task i need to achieve is pretty simple, just switching an led onoff. Pic microcontrollers with integrated lcd driver module. The data received by the bluetooth are processed by 8051 microcontroller which performs the desired action. Maxim integrateds 32bit microcontrollers embed technologies to secure data and intellectual property.
It is probably the smallest arduino ble board in the market. Apr 26, 2017 the command mode will be left to the default settings. The simplelink cc2652p device is a multiprotocol 2. It uses standard arduino ide to upload codes via without any extra library and drivers. Specifications, support documents, and additional tools available at digikey. Bluno nano arduino ble bluetooth microcontroller robotshop. Fully integrated bluetooth ble softdevice for appconnected projects and wireless boardtoboard communication.
Optimal peripheral mix provides platform scalability. It is the ideal addon to existing microcontroller mcu solutions, offering wifi and bluetooth low energy ble network capabilities through a spitowifi interface. Bluetooth lowenergy master and slave stack are integrated which can be used for 2way communication with any. Renesas provides a smart configurator, implemented in a gui, that can generate all types of mcu peripheral function driver code and pin settings for the e 2 studio integrated development environment ide to generate the bluetooth driver code. Also, there are few microcontrollers with integrated bluetooth and wifi, such as esp32, but they are just mcu and bluetooth module in one ic. There is more flexibility in segment control than in a dedicated driver chip solution. They should have called it the fleaduino a small board with mad reach. What is the cheapest, smallest microcontroller with. Csr1010 qfn is designed to provide virtually everything required to create a bluetooth low energy product with rf, baseband, mcu, qualified bluetooth v4. Microcontroller integrated circuits lapis semiconductor. Microchip offers a complete line of products to meet the needs of highperformance embedded applications using the can protocol, including 8bit, 16bit and 32bit microcontrollers, 32bit microprocessors and digital signal controllers dscs with integrated can, external can controllers and can transceivers. In this project we are using at89s52 microcontroller. The rn4871 click carries the rn4871 bluetooth low energy module from microchip.
The microchip advantage microchips lcd pic microcontroller family is a flashbased, power managed family of lcdenabled microcontrollers. Stm32f103 microcontroller controlling stepper motor by a4988. The bluetooth module is directly interfaced to the microcontroller of rx and tx pins as it doesnt need any external middle ware devices. Jun 19, 2016 texas instruments and nordic semiconductor are two ble chip vendors. Find proven microcontroller analog circuitry and batteryconserving. Renesas electronics delivers enhanced security and privacy.
The atwinc3400 also features an onchip processor and integrated flash. Bluno family is first of its kind in intergrating bt 4. This beetle ble is another milestone in the beetle line, which makes diy users have more options. The cc2540 combines an excellent rf transceiver with an industrystandard enhanced 8051 mcu, insystem programmable flash memory, 8kb ram. The bluetooth module is a transceiver module constructed with a transmitter and receiver. This single chip solution features bluetooth low energy ble, basic rate br, and enhanced data rate. The l298n motor driver module is more frequently used driver ics nowadays. Bluetoothble modules with integrated microcontroller. Dec 10, 2019 renesas provides a smart configurator, implemented in a gui, that can generate all types of mcu peripheral function driver code and pin settings for the e2 studio integrated development environment ide to generate the bluetooth driver code.
Texas instruments and nordic semiconductor are two ble chip vendors. These tools unlock the power and flexibility of the 8bit microcontroller family. Sam and thirdparty microcontrollers mcus for maximum design flexibility while. Drop our prototyping boards right into your own project and. Cypress semiconductor cyw20719 bredrble bluetooth 5.
So, lets get started to see how to control pic microcontrollers wirelessly with a. Modules are currently being developed that integrate the entire external rf and. Interfacing a bluetooth module to the microcontroller. The bluno nano arduino ble bluetooth microcontroller is perfect for ble projects with limited space or weight. The beetle ble former name as bluno beetle is an arduino uno based board with bluetooth 4. Building reusable device drivers for microcontrollers. Design of automobiles using android controlled technology. Nov 22, 2014 interfacing a bluetooth module to the microcontroller. Rfduino coinsized arduino microcontroller with bluetooth 4. Benefits of integrated lcd control module the benefits of integrating the lcd control module within a flashbased pic microcontroller are numerous and can be quickly appreciated by any design engineer. Interfacing hc05 bluetooth module with atmega8 avr. The device name will be hc05 i am using hc06 and the password will be 0000 or 1234 and most importantly the default baud rate for all bluetooth modules will be 9600. Max32565 secure arm cortexm4 with fpubased microcontroller mcu with contactless interface and bluetooth radio secure cortexm4f microcontroller with integrated contactless interface, btle 4.
Renesas provides a smart configurator, implemented in a gui, that can generate all types of mcu peripheral function driver code and pin settings for the e2 studio integrated development environment ide to generate the bluetooth driver code. Bluetooth driver installer free download and software. As discussed in the previous tutorial, a microcontroller interfaces and interacts with other. Darwin is a new breed of lowpower microcontrollers built to thrive in the. The stm32 wireless mcus support bluetooth 5 standard as well as the 802.
The cc2540 is a costeffective, lowpower, true systemonchip soc for bluetooth low energy applications. In the previous tutorial, we discussed the basics about arduino sketches, with a a quick arduino language reference. Wc7220b0 from wi2wis mcu embedded series is a hostless singlemode bluetooth low energy ble module with integrated chip antenna. So connecting the reset with sleep makes reset pin high, now driver will never reset. Silicon labs offers an advanced 8bit microcontroller studio, available at no charge to developers. The kw30z is an ultra lowpower, highlyintegrated singlechip device that. So if you want to power motor driver with 5 volts you can simply change the connection. Renesas electronics introduces the rx23w microcontroller delivering enhanced security and privacy for bluetooth 5 connections for iot endpoint devices. New opensource neoplc board design allows stacking, soldering, clipping boards together into any shape that fits your project, with no wiring mess. It uses ascii command interface over uart for communication with target microcontroller, with additional functionality provided by the following pins on the mikrobus line. Dogan ibrahim, in armbased microcontroller projects using mbed, 2019. Here the bluetooth module acts as an interface between our mobile and pic16f877a board.
Integrated module with bluetooth wireless technology for microsoft windows 7. Stm32wb55vg ultralowpower dual core arm cortexm4 mcu 64. Completely programmable over usb with the arduino ide, the highspeed cortex m4f processor with floating point unit allows blazing fast calculation and communication. In communication, the bluetooth wireless technology has become very popular and it is one of the fastest growing fields in the wireless technology. Description the sam r21 and sam r30 are a series of featurerich, extremely lowpower 2. A method for driver abstraction is examined in addition to a brief look at key c language features. The mcu also includes renesass trusted secure ip, featured in its rx mcu family, to address bluetooth security risks such as eavesdropping, tampering, and viruses. Sep 22, 2018 the l298n motor driver module is more frequently used driver ics nowadays. Interfacing led and driving digital output from a source is the hello world of embedded systems.
In this tutorial, well control the pic microcontroller using a smartphone and a pc via bluetooth. At this point, the bluetooth driver and the serial port driver are both registered as. Stm32 wireless microcontrollers mcu stmicroelectronics. This single chip solution features bluetooth low energy ble, basic rate br, and enhanced data rate edr for bluetooth 5.
Reset pin is a floating pin and sleep pin is normally pulled upsee the above driver equivalent circuit. A layered approach to software design will be explored with common driver design patterns for timers, io, and spi which can then be expanded upon to develop drivers for additional peripherals across a wide range of processor platforms. Stm32f103 microcontroller controlling stepper motor by. Developing device drivers for a highly integrated microcontroller can be daunting, partly. Microcontrollers with integrated lcd segment drivers.
Renesas also developed a qe for ble that can generate programs for custom profiles and embed them in. Sts stm32wb mcu series features microcontrollers supporting bluetooth 5 and. Bluetooth driver installer free bluetoothinstaller windows xpvista7 version 1. Interfacing bluetooth module hc06 with pic microcontroller. These robust and reliable bluetooth le with mcu modules are packed with efficient power management architecture which will extend battery life from months to years.
If you dont see the bluetooth component, restart your system and repeat above steps again. So as not to overload this tutorial, well postpone the communication of 2 pic microcontrollers via bluetooth in which the 1 st one is a master and the 2 nd one is a slave to be in a separate future tutorial. The rn4870 click carries the rn4870 bluetooth low energy module from microchip. Bluetooth lowenergy master and slave stack are integrated which can be used for 2way communication with any other standard btle enabled deivces. It enables robust ble master or slave nodes to be built with very low total billofmaterial costs. Trying to build a boost converter using a pic microcontroller with minimum number of external components. Practical implementations of bluetooth in microcontroller. Click start button in the bottom left corner of the screen. Was hoping to find an nmos with integrated driver dashed rectangle above in a small surface mount package e. I do not believe the vista driver will work the bluetooth under w7. Sep 11, 2019 so if you want to power motor driver with 5 volts you can simply change the connection. Body and comfort, adas and driver replacement, vehicle networking. Nov 03, 2016 in communication, the bluetooth wireless technology has become very popular and it is one of the fastest growing fields in the wireless technology. An android controlled automobile allows the user to control a battery power automobile wirelessly through an android device.
They both contain an integrated antenna so pretty much all you have to do is supply 3. Google for the ti cc2564 and the nordic nrf51 series. Low power arm cortexm4 with fpubased microcontroller with bluetooth 5 for. Stm32wb55vg ultralowpower dual core arm cortexm4 mcu. This process is quite different from others since we are going to use android mobile to control and communicate with pic16f877a. If the issue persists, see contact support at the bottom of this page. The bluenrg2 is the new generation of the bluetooth low energy ble systemonchip single core, with a generous integrated 256kbyte flash memory, scalable gpio pins and up to 105 c operating temperature. The atwinc3400 connects to any microchip pic or sam mcu with minimal resource requirements. We will establish communication between android mobile and atmega8 through bluetooth module which takes place through uart serial communication protocol. All c8051fxxx families are supported by the 8bit studio. For more information on l298n motor driver module, refer to the a brief note on l298n motor driver. The stm32wb55xx multiprotocol wireless and ultralowpower devices embed a powerful and ultralowpower radio compliant with the bluetooth low energy sig specification v5. What is the cheapest, smallest microcontroller with bluetooth.
The data line that transmits data from the bluetooth module to the microcontroller can be connected directly since the 3. The bluenrg2 comes in both qfn32 and the new qfn48 package that offers 26 gpios. With the lcd module on board the pic microcontroller, overall design is simplified for an immediate reduction in component count. This system has a bluetooth module as a medium of data transfer between the automobile and the android device. Secure arm cortexm4 with fpubased microcontroller mcu. Sot235 to use as the switch and drive it directly from the pic output pin. Hp integrated module with bluetooth wireless technology for.
However i got interested in whether it is possible without one. Lcd microcontroller family complements an already extensive product portfolio by providing the greatest breadth of lcd segment drivers, package sizes and integrated features for embedded control applications. Upgrade bluetooth drivers for your acer travelmate laptop. Secure cortexm4f microcontroller with integrated contactless interface, btle 4. A mcu host driver can be found in the advanced software framework asf. Youll want complete modules chip, power conversion, analog, antenna, firmware and not the bare chip. Bluetooth module interfacing with pic16f877a embetronicx. If your 8051 device does not appear in the list below, you can also use simplicity studio software suite. This selfcontained ble module with onboard microcontroller, embedded ble 4. This is the latest w7 version of the hp bluetooth software and driver.
Ultralow power bluetooth low energy soc for portable health care, wearable. Embedded systems device driver development page 1 of 9. I have recently bought a bluetooth hc05 module, and have followed many tutorials on integrating it with an arduino, or a microcontroller. Intergrated bluetooth and wifi microcontroller reference design. It is a high voltage, high current dual fullbridge driver designed to accept standard ttl logic levels and. Single chip lcd driver solutions have proven to be very popular and microcontrollers with integrated lcd segment drivers are available from a microchip 8bit pic series to arm cortex 32bit microcontrollers. Android controlled robot using 8051 microcontroller at89s52. Mar 27, 2020 in the previous tutorial, we discussed the basics about arduino sketches, with a a quick arduino language reference. The program given below is the hc05 bluetooth module interfacing with pic16f877a. Mar 18, 20 they should have called it the fleaduino a small board with mad reach. These microcontrollers includes original noise immunity circuits, are suitable for temperature measurements, motor controls and led lighting controls. The current and voltage ratings of l298n are higher than that of l293d motor driver.
24 170 166 1133 1245 767 1447 1109 1481 421 1418 254 1009 514 2 1115 1085 1146 383 579 1137 753 362 584 1430 1244 96 299 1421 1343 806 361 234 261 1409 1097 1332 1093 911 626 1089 439 471 946 1326 458